(Photo thanks to Steve McCaw).Various other subject matters ranged from the ability for customized risk examinations for popular cancers cells to just how genetic changes as well as environmental elements may support neurodevelopmental as well as neuropsychiatric problems.Mitochondrial diseases.Expense Copeland, Ph.D., mind of the NIEHS Genome Integrity and Structural The field of biology Research laboratory, discussed his work taking a look at hereditary anomalies in human mitochondria, which are actually organelles that provide cells along with energy they require to perform appropriately. Several of those mutations can easily trigger health conditions like modern outside ophthalmoplegia, a disorder noted by eye muscular tissue weakness and incapacity to appear left or even appropriate, among other bodily issues." Mitochondrial DNA lack specific repair procedures," took note Copeland. "We assume the majority of anomalies are actually formed coming from spontaneous errors of mitochondrial DNA duplication that are actually only not repaired." Replication is actually when DNA is actually copied throughout cellular division.One replication error entails DNA removal. Copeland illustrated his task LostArc, which determined 35 million deletions in 22 people along with and also 19 patients without a mutation of the gene POLG, which participates in a primary part in mitochondrial DNA duplication. (Picture courtesy of Steve McCaw).Experts think that chemical changes to RNA are involved in amount of essential biological methods, like temperature level naturalization and gene expression. How the setting may affect those complex improvements, which are actually recognized together as the epitranscriptome, was the emphasis of talks by a number of NIEHS beneficiaries, including Juliane Beier, Ph.D., coming from the Educational institution of Pittsburgh.She provided a presentation entitled "The Epitranscriptome at the Crossroads of Diet Plan as well as Environmental Direct Exposure in Liver Conditions." Beier has presented that visibility to vinyl fabric chloride, also at levels currently taken into consideration secure, might worsen ailments for people with nonalcoholic fatty liver disease. That chemical is an inconsistent natural compound made use of to make products including polyvinyl chloride, or PVC, pipelines.
